Louis "Louie" DeNonno, known in Japan and Korea as Louis Franco[1][2], is a friend of Kyle Hyde who works as a bellhop in Hotel Dusk. Previously, he used to pick pockets in New York City. He is a major character in Hotel Dusk: Room 215.
Background[]
As Louis was growing up, he bonded with a person called Danny. He became friends with him, as both shared similar lives. The two friends were both street pick pockets, notably in New York and Louis' constant thieving resulted in Kyle arresting him on many occasions. Danny and Louis didn't have relatives or family, making them orphans essentially. Under Nile, Danny acted as their delivery boy, carrying the money the criminal organization made with insurance fraud and art theft. Louis on the other hand was seemingly just a thief who worked for them and Kyle claims that Louis also worked at a pizza joint in the East Village.
As adults, they were a part of a plan which involved stealing an extremely rare and expensive collector's painting from Nile's warehouse. They attempted to steal this painting to free themselves from their need to steal any more money. Danny wished to live a better life along with Louis, as both felt they couldn't keep working for Nile. If the plan worked, they would escape from the city as people with new identities. Danny became obsessed with this plan and even planned to take Nile's entire collection. Louis thought it was too risky and tried to stop him, but Danny refused. The two agreed to meet at a restaurant if the job was a success.
Danny went on to pursue his plan while carrying Nile's money from a recent operation at the time, however, he didn't come to the restaurant as established. Worried, Louis went to Nile's warehouse and as soon as he began opening the door, he heard a gunshot. Louis hid immediately, and peeked from the door; inside the room was J with a gun in his hand, and Danny, laid on the floor, wounded and crying. Louis did not intervene, as he lacked any weapon, until J left along with Nile's money and the angel painting. Under weak breath, Danny apologized to Louis for his failure in acquiring them the money, and explained that J double-crossed him, as he was in fact an undercover cop.
After his death, Louis was forced to leave the city due to grief. He went to Los Angeles, California and ended up working at Hotel Dusk.
Hotel Dusk: Room 215[]
When Kyle gets his package in Chapter 1, Louis attempts to anonymously deliver the package and get away without being noticed for his identity, but he is recognized by Kyle due to way he talked.
He later speaks with him about what happened with Brian and Danny in his room. It's through Kyle that he finds out Nile suspect Louis of stealing their money, resulting in Louis panicking and confessing to Kyle that he left Manhattan to get over Danny's death and not simply because he wanted to.
Personality[]
When he was younger, Louis was somewhat greedy but when he moved to Los Angeles, he changed his ways. Nowadays, he is generally friendly to people however he can appear violent when angry or sad, which is triggered by any mention of Danny. Other than that, Louis can be quite lazy to the point Rosa sees him as useless (to the point she says she has to do everything herself) and Dunning wants to sack him if he slacks off any further. Louis also acts like a "dunce" sometimes and he has an affinity toward 'hot' girls - such as Mila or the models from the girlie mag Kyle was instructed to find. Louis can also fake a formal demeanor as shown in Chapter 3.

Kyle Hyde[]
Louis had many run-ins with Kyle during his time as a pickpocket in NY. Kyle often had to interrogate him, telling him to stop his pickpocketing for good. The two of them decide to become proper friends during Hotel Dusk: Room 215, so Kyle doesn't get kicked out for snooping around the hotel.
Mila Evans[]
Louis has a crush on Mila for her appearance. He was interested on her, but he was often 'ignored' by Mila whenever he tried to talk to her. Later, when Mila gets to hear Dunning's whole story about Robert Evans, Nile, Brian and Danny, Louis supports Mila staying, as he understood that it was important for her as it is for him to learn the whole story about what happened to Danny.
Brian Bradley[]
Louis knows Bradley as J through Danny talking about him. After seeing Bradley kill Danny, he is shown to hate Bradley for what he did.

Trivia[]
- He only appears in Hotel Dusk: Room 215, but his song appears again in Last Window: Secret of Cape West.
- In Another Code: R - A Journey into Lost Memories, his photo can be found.
- In chapter 10, Louis mentioned a cartoon with a dog and a guy who is always hungry when he discovers a hidden door with Kyle. This is possibly referencing the Scooby-Doo franchise because it could refer to the characters, Scooby and Shaggy. This is seen only in the English, Spanish, and German translations.
